Dopamine addiction in entrepreneurs is the hidden reason so many businesses feel busy but stuck. In this episode, Matthew Tompkins and Lance Pendleton break down the dopamine trap; the cycle of chasing new ideas, tools, and chaos while struggling to finish the work that actually creates momentum.

They explain why dopamine isn't driven by outcomes, but by the anticipation of outcomes and how that chemical loop turns entrepreneurs into serial starters who lose interest the moment the excitement fades. From unfinished projects and constant pivots to creative highs followed by crashes, this conversation exposes why motion replaces progress in so many entrepreneurial lives.

Matthew shares real stories from television, radio, and business where dopamine-fueled creativity drove success and nearly destroyed consistency. Lance breaks down the neuroscience behind dopamine drops, novelty addiction, and why entrepreneurs chase the next hit instead of seeing things through.

If your days are full of activity but short on results, this episode will show you why you start but never finish and how to escape the dopamine trap without killing your creativity.
